yhkn.net
当前位置:首页 >> hql联表查询 >>

hql联表查询

HIbernate主要常用有三种查询方式HQL、QBC、SQL:1).HQL(Hibernate Query Language):hibernate数据查询语言;2).QBC(Query By Criteria):规则查询3).SQL:原生的SQL语句(较为复杂的情况下使用)想要详细了解的可以看一下下面的几篇文章:

用sqlquery query=session.createsql();来操作就好了,多表联合查询因为没有对应的pojo类,很麻烦.用原生的sql就可以直接用你上面的sql语句了

list里面放的都是同一类型的数据两个对象是不能放在一个集合里面的.

一、 Hibernate简介Hibernate是一个JDO工具.它的工作原理是通过文件(一般有两种:xml文件和properties文件)把值对象和数据库表之间建立起一个映射关系.这样,我们只需要通过操作这些值对象和Hibernate提供的一些基本类,就可以达

有两种:一种是hql 语句,一种是session.find(对象名.class,自动标示符);

转录: 从点到面,讲讲hibernate查询的6种方法.分别是hql查询 ,对象化查询criteria方法,动态查询detachedcriteria,例子查询,sql查询,命名查询. 如果单纯的使用hibernate查询数据库只需要懂其中的一项就可以完成想要实现的一般功能

如果库中两张表是有关系的 生成时就会有one-to-many,你只需写:String hql="select " + "t.emp.empid," + "t.emp.empname," + "t.marketproject.marketprojectid," + "t.marketproject.marketprojectname," + "t.marketTargetid," + "t.

有三种方式,不过不是楼上说的那三种.1.HQL查询2.QBC查询3.本地SQL查询

HIBERNATE查询和普通的SQL语句是一样的,只不过HIBERNATE这个ORM使得我们可以进行面向对象的查询.建议楼主看下HIBERNATE查询用得多的是用SPRING提供的import org.springframework.orm.hibernate3.s

hibernate的关联查询实现方法,比如有存在关联的表A和表B字段分别如下:A:id,aName,aDescB:id,aId,bName,bDesc希望查询的结果是:A.id,B.id,A.aName,B.bName,B.bDesc1.按照如下步骤操作:①创建A和B的hibernate映射,相互不用关联

相关文档
网站首页 | 网站地图
All rights reserved Powered by www.yhkn.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com